Did you know that travel is big business for San Antonio? San Antonio hosts some 37 million visitors a year, which in turn creates an annual influx of $15.2 billion to the local economy.
Did you also know that travel is one of the top 5 industries in San Antonio, providing more than 140,188 local jobs? Travel is serving San Antonio in more ways than you may realize. It is called the San Antonio Travel Effect, and it is responsible for creating jobs, stimulating business development, funding city projects and enriching the culture and vibrancy of San Antonio.

San Antonio has been noted time and again as one of the most recession-proof cities in the U.S. (according to the Brookings Institution), with the travel and tourism industry being cited as one of the major contributing factors.

Travel and tourism is also a leading industry nationally. In 2018, travel generated $2.5 trillion for the U.S. economy, supporting 15.7 million American jobs.
